The Primetime Emmy Awards air on different channels and streamers depending on the year and your country, but the 2026 ceremony (78th Emmys) is set for Monday, September 14, 2026 , live from the Peacock Theater in Los Angeles.

Where to watch in the U.S.

For 2026 , the main options are:

  • NBC – The Emmys will air live coast‑to‑coast on NBC at 8 p.m. ET / 5 p.m. PT.
  • Peacock – NBC’s streaming service will carry a live stream of the ceremony at the same time.

If you’re a cord‑cutter, you can also use a live‑TV streaming service that includes NBC (such as YouTube TV, Hulu + Live TV, or Fubo), then watch the Emmys via their apps or web players.
